Wuzhen Travel Guide: How to Explore This Water Town Like a Pro

Driving directly from Hangzhou to Wuzhen in 1.5 hours, you can deeply experience the culture of Dongzha and the night view of Xizha, and feel the most authentic Jiangnan water town style.

Starting from downtown Hangzhou, take the Hangzhou Ningbo Expressway and then transfer to the Shenjiahu Expressway, covering a total distance of 85 kilometers and taking approximately 1.5 hours. Suggest setting the navigation endpoint as "Wuzhen Xizha No.1 Parking Lot", with sufficient parking spaces and closest to the entrance of the scenic area. Before departure, it is recommended to check the real-time traffic conditions and avoid the morning rush hour. 1. Dongzha Morning: The Original Colors of the Water Town Through Thousands of Years

It is recommended to arrive at Dongzha before the park opens at 7:30. At this time, there are few tourists and the scent of morning tea wafts along the bluestone road.

[Must Check in Point]

Mao Dun's former residence: a small wooden structure building in the late Qing Dynasty, with a yellowed manuscript of "Midnight" displayed in the study

Fengyuan Shuangqiao: Standing on the arch of Tongji Bridge, it can simultaneously frame the city river in the morning mist and the horse head walls on both sides

Hongyuan Tai Dyeing Workshop: Watching indigo flower cloth sway gently in the wind between bamboo poles, experienced craftsmen demonstrate the rolling dyeing technique on site

【 Travel Tips 】 Dongzha ticket is 110 yuan, it is recommended to play for 2 hours. You can bring your own Hanfu for taking photos, and the soft light in the morning is the best for taking pictures.

2. Complete Guide to Xizha: Immersive Journey from Sunset to Starry Night

It is recommended to enter by boat from Andufang Pier (60 yuan/person). The 45 minute water tour route will pass through:

Zhaoming Academy: Exhibition Hall for Restoration of Ming Dynasty Ancient Books, where you can experience woodblock printing

Water Theater: Outdoor Pingtan performances are often held in the evening, and the tea table fee starts at 58 yuan, including refreshments

Grass and Wood Natural Color Dyeing Workshop: Giant Dyeing Jars and Cloth Drying Shelves Form a Natural Art Installation

After nightfall:

White Lotus Pagoda: Take the elevator to the 7th floor observation deck and overlook the entire West Gate lights

Shuishikou: Watching the martial arts performance of the boxing boat, the bow of the boat moves freely despite being only a small piece of land


3. Food Radar: Water Town Taste Map

Must eat experience:

Shusheng Lamb Noodles (Xizha Street): Crispy lamb with skin paired with fine noodles, 38 yuan/bowl

Dingsheng Cake (Dongzha Caishen Bay): Pink rice cake with bean paste embedded, 3 yuan/piece

San Baijiu (Gaogongsheng Distillery): traditional rice flavor Baijiu, 28 yuan/half jin

Guide to Avoiding Pits: Be cautious when entering the "Wuzhen Tu Cai Guan" outside the scenic area. It is recommended to try the homestay meals in Xizha, where you can enjoy authentic dishes such as steamed white water fish and pickled duck for 80 yuan per person.


4. Accommodation options: N ways to live by the water

Budget type: Xizha Outer Homestay Cluster, recommended "Ciyun Inn", 10 minutes' walk to the scenic area, including breakfast starting from 280 yuan

Experience oriented: Tong'an Inn Water Room, open the window and you will see a rowing boat, 680 yuan including scenic spot tickets

Parent child type: Wucun Rice House Rural Hotel, with rice field swimming pool and animal farm, 880 yuan package including activity experience
